Nnamdi Kanu’s wife breaks silence, dismisses divorce rumours

Uchechi Okwu-Kanu, the wife of Nnamdi Kanu, detained Indigenous People of Biafra (IPOB) leader, has dismissed reports alleging that she has filed for divorce from her husband, describing the claims as false and misleading.
In a statement shared on her verified X account on Friday, Okwu-Kanu said she was compelled to respond after noticing what she described as unverified reports circulating online.
“For the avoidance of doubt, I have not filed for divorce. The publication is entirely false and should be treated as misinformation,” she stated.
She expressed disappointment over the spread of what she described as fabricated stories about her family without proper verification, warning that such reports undermine responsible journalism.
Okwu-Kanu urged members of the public to rely only on information released directly by her or through her authorised representatives, while appreciating those who contacted her to verify the claim before sharing it.
She has been married to Nnamdi Kanu since 2009.
Kanu is currently serving a life sentence at the Sokoto Custodial Centre after he was convicted on terrorism-related charges by the federal high court in Abuja in November 2025.
Following his conviction, the IPOB leader filed an appeal before the Court of Appeal, seeking to overturn the judgment.
